The city lies approximately 20 miles west of Detroit, offering access to downtown cultural venues such as the Detroit Institute of Arts and the Detroit Riverwalk within a 30–40 minute drive. Local recreation includes Hines Park with multi-use trails and nearby Kensington Metropark about 25 miles northwest featuring lakes, beaches, and boating. Commuting is facilitated by major roadways including I-275 and US-12, with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port approximately 15 miles southeast for regional and national travel.
